Seminole Hard Rock Tampa discovers two ‘suspicious devices’ inside casino

The space was evacuated late Sunday night and on Monday afternoon.
Key Points
- Both devices were removed from the casino
- Police said these are thought to contain fireworks components
The Seminole Hard Rock Tampa was recently evacuated twice after two “suspicious devices” were discovered inside, according to an Associated Press report.
The casino hotel was evacuated once on Sunday night and a second time Monday, officials told the AP.
Tribal police went on to note that these devices had “fireworks components” and described them as “crude concealed devices.”
Police said in a news release that one device was found in a men’s restroom near the casino “shortly before midnight” and the space was evacuated.
The Hillsborough County Sheriff’s Office Bomb Disposal Team removed the device, and the casino reopened close to 3AM, officials said.
The second device was discovered the next day around noon in another men’s restroom. Following evacuation, the second device was removed and deactivated.
Police discovered the second device during its investigation into the first one.
However, police did not give specifics as to how dangerous the devices were or who left them in the facility.
Tribal police are working with the sheriff’s office as well as with the FBI to investigate the matter further. A motive has not been reported at this time.
However, surveillance video is currently under review, the report said. All casino areas are now open and available for guests.
The Seminole Tribe of Florida acquired the Hard Rock brand in 2007. Since Hard Rock’s founding, the brand has globally expanded to include more than 250 locations.
The company recently relaunched Hard Rock Bet in Florida, giving players statewide access to mobile sports betting.
